Terms and Conditions
1. Booking and Cancellation Policy:
- Bookings can only be cancelled before they are accepted by the supplier.
- Once a booking is accepted by the supplier, cancellations are not allowed, and refunds will not be provided.
2. Rider Responsibilities:
- The customer must possess a valid driver's license appropriate for the type of vehicle being rented.
- The customer is required to inspect the vehicle before accepting it and provide the 2-digit handover code to the supplier (if complete payment by card) or pay the remaining balance in cash (if only deposit paid on card). By providing the handover code or paying the remaining balance, the customer acknowledges that they have inspected the vehicle, found it to be in acceptable condition, and are satisfied with its state. After providing the handover code or paying the remaining balance, no refunds can be granted if the customer later claims that the vehicle did not meet their requirements or was in poor condition.
- The customer agrees to wear a helmet, appropriate clothing, and to obey all local traffic laws. Drinking and driving is strictly prohibited.
- The customer shall not make any modifications or repairs to the vehicle without prior written consent from the supplier.
- The customer agrees to be liable for any loss, damages, traffic violations, fines, or penalties incurred during the rental period due to accident, theft, or any other causes arising from the customer's negligence, lack of skill, or lack of foresight.
- The customer further agrees not to lend the vehicle to any other persons during the rental period.
3. Supplier Responsibilities:
- The supplier is responsible for verifying that the customer possesses a valid driver's license and is legally allowed to operate the vehicle being rented.
- The supplier shall provide a vehicle in proper working condition and maintain it throughout the rental period.
- If the supplier is unable to provide the same vehicle the customer booked, such as in the case of double bookings or vehicle malfunctions, they are required to provide an alternative vehicle of equal or higher quality at no additional cost to the customer.
- The supplier may not change the price of the booking after it has been accepted. After the booking has been accepted this price is fixed until the end of the rental period. This applies to short-term bookings and monthly subscriptions where the customer is charged every month.
- If the payment is completely done by card through the app, the supplier must obtain the 2-digit handover code from the customer upon delivering the vehicle. If the supplier fails to input the handover code into the Flexbike app within 7 days of the rental period start date, they will not receive their payout.

9. Commission:
- Flexbike charges a commission on each rental transaction facilitated through the platform. The commission is a percentage of the total rental amount and is deducted from the payment made by the customer before the remaining balance is released to the supplier.
- The commission rate is subject to change at Flexbike's discretion. Any changes to the commission structure will be communicated to suppliers in advance.
- Suppliers are responsible for taking the commission into account when setting their rental prices.
10. Circumvention of Platform:
- Suppliers and customers are prohibited from engaging in any transactions or communications that attempt to bypass the Flexbike platform, including but not limited to arranging for direct cash payments or providing contact information for the purpose of conducting transactions outside of the platform.
- Any attempts to circumvent the platform and avoid paying the commission will be considered a violation of these terms and conditions.
- Flexbike reserves the right to terminate the accounts of suppliers or customers who engage in such activities and pursue legal action if necessary.
